What is a Viewing Facility?

Viewing facility or viewing studios as they are sometimes known provide a professional venue from where market research discussions and interviews (also known as focus groups or depth interviews)  can be conducted. Primarily, the main difference from a viewing facility or any other venue i.e. a home setup, hotel conference room, etc can be seen in the setup. A viewing facility will have one-way mirrors within their studios allowing clients to unobtrusively observe respondents who are partaking in a market research studies. In addition, the viewing studio would provide technologies that allow the discussions to be recorded onto a variety of media such as audio cassette tapes, DVD’s, video’s, etc which can then be analysed by the researcher at a future date.

facility can differ widely in terms of size, cost, level of technology and the services offered ranging from very basic small scale facility often within peoples homes to large purpose built studios with highly specific market research technologies and services.  It’s always a good idea to examine what different facility can offer before deciding on a venue to conduct research.

Why use a viewing facility?

Viewing facility are most commonly used for conducting qualitative research.  Rather than examining statistics to understand a market or product (quantitative research) which has limitations with analysis, qualitative research attempts to gather information through direct conversation with a group of or individual respondents.  This enables the evaluation of responses to various stimuli, often including advertising, presentation, packaging, brochures, and websites, for example.  The exploration of a respondent’s opinion of such stimuli can provide the client with an in-depth understanding of how their product is perceived, as well as providing inspiration for how to expand or improve the product or service.

Viewing studios facilitate this through providing a suitable environment for discussions to occur, and generally also provide video and audio recording options, one-way mirrored viewing rooms, hostess service, refreshment and catering options.  Other services which may be offered, depending on the size and technology of the studio include remote viewing via the internet, web usability testing and eye-tracking technologies.
